I am going to copy down Prod to UAT (including all data and customizations), what do I need to do in UAT so that emails wont be sent to users?  
 
I still want the workflows/flows to run so that it shows up in the timeline of the record, I just don't want the end users to get the email from the UAT environment.

    Your request to migrate a Prod database to a UAT database is supported.
     
    According to Microsoft's official documentation, when you refresh a database in a UAT environment using Prod environment data, certain elements in the database are not copied to the target environment during the refresh operation. One of these elements is the e-mail addresses in the /LogisticsElectronicAddress / table. Based on this information we guess that after the refresh operation, the e-mail addresses in the production environment will not appear in the UAT environment and no e-mails will be sent to the users.

     
    In addition, the documentation mentions that it is also possible to disable the SMTP relay server in the /SysEmailParameters/ table to prevent e-mail from being sent from the UAT environment.
